April 8 A World Without Nuclear Weapons: Obama's Vision, Our Mission

Peace Action Fund of New York State and The Nation Institute present A World Without Nuclear Weapons with Daniel Ellsberg, whistle-blower, nuclear expert and star of the academy-nominated documentary, The Most Dangerous Man in America Jonathan Schell, bestselling author of The Fate of the Earth and The Unconquerable World, and Nuclear Weapons Doris Shaffer Fellow at The Nation Institute Kennette Benedict, Publisher of the Bulletin of Atomic Scientists Moderated by Phil Donahue "The United States will take concrete steps towards a world without nuclear weapons." – President Barack Obama, April 5, 2009 Join our panel of leading experts in a wide-ranging and incisive conversation on the ongoing international struggle for the containment and eventual reduction of the nuclear threat, and how President Obama and the U.S. Senate can be pushed to fulfill the promise of a world without nuclear weapons. This important public conversation is occurring in the run-up to the UN’s regular review of the Nuclear Non-Proliferation Treaty that will take place on May 1, 2010. Audience questions will be taken.
